Digitalalertsystems

First CVE: Jun 30, 2013Active for: 13 yearsTotal CVEs: 7

Digitalalertsystems develops a focused line of digital alert and notification systems (DASDEC product family across multiple versions), with vulnerabilities centered on cross-site scripting and input-handling weaknesses affecting the web-facing interface layers.
